Explore Derek Black's transition from white supremacy to anti-racism, from being groomed as a prominent figure in a racist community to his journey of self-discovery and rejecting hate, as recounted in his memoir, 'The Klansmen's Son'.
R. Derek Black grew up with the founders of the American white nationalist movement but became an advocate for antiracism. How did that happen?
